Madison, WI– Today, ABC for Health, Inc. updated its popular “FPL Calculator” using 2019 numbers set by the Federal Government. The Federal Poverty Level, or “FPL,” is a benchmark of the minimum amount of gross income a family is determined to need for food, clothing, transportation, shelter, health, and other necessities established by the federal government. FPL varies according to income and family size, and is adjusted annually based on consumer price index. The federal government released the 2019 FPL numbers, with a January 11, 2019 effective date for certain programs.

The ABC for Health FPL calculator is available free online at: https://safetyweb.org/fpl.php

“FPL is one criteria for determining eligibility for health coverage programs like BadgerCare Plus,” says Bobby Peterson, Public Interest Attorney at ABC for Health. “People use our online FPL calculator frequently to help assess possible eligibility for programs. In 2018, our calculator generated over 235,000 clicks.”

Peterson continues, “Remember, these new numbers will impact new applications for BadgerCare Plus and Medicaid programs, which look at your current, monthly income. Individuals applying for private insurance through the Federal Marketplace, however, will have eligibility based on their 2018 annual income.” Peterson says the ABC for Health calculator page has links to the 2018 numbers for those evaluating Marketplace coverage and FoodShare eligibility.

Peterson concludes, “It’s incredibly important that individuals, families and their advocates have access to tools to help them assess and secure available health coverage and other important safety net services. While the new poverty level numbers were not published in the Federal Register, due to the partial government shutdown, the effective date of January 11, 2019, as published by the US Department of Health and Human Services is firm.”

Celebrating 25 years in 2019, ABC for Health, Inc., is a Wisconsin-based, nonprofit, public interest law firm dedicated to linking children and families, particularly those with special health care needs, to health care benefits and services. ABC for Health’s mission is to provide information, advocacy tools, legal services, and expert support needed to obtain, maintain, and finance health care coverage and services
